[MGNLFORM-75] Allow simpler FormEngine subclassing Created: 22/Dec/10  Updated: 19/Jan/11  Resolved: 19/Jan/11

Status: Closed
Project: Magnolia Form Module
Component/s: None
Affects Version/s: None
Fix Version/s: 1.2.1

Type: Improvement Priority: Neutral
Reporter: Magnolia International Assignee: Philipp Bärfuss
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Attachments: Text File form_let_form_state_be_manageable_by_engine_.patch    
Issue Links:
relation
is related to MGNLSTK-735 Logout results in session expired err... Closed
Template:
Patch included:
Yes
Acceptance criteria:
Empty
Task DoD:
[ ]* Doc/release notes changes? Comment present?
[ ]* Downstream builds green?
[ ]* Solution information and context easily available?
[ ]* Tests
[ ]* FixVersion filled and not yet released
[ ]  Architecture Decision Record (ADR)
Date of First Response:

 Description   

By extracting a few methods from FormEngine (currently delegated to FormStateUtil), one could achieve a session-less FormEngine implementation in just a few lines of code without redundancy.
See attached patch.



 Comments   
Comment by Magnolia International [ 22/Dec/10 ]

Committed the patch for now - further improvements possibly coming up

Comment by Philipp Bärfuss [ 19/Jan/11 ]

marking this issue as resolved as the requested changes were implemented

Generated at Mon Feb 12 05:36:37 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.